I am on track to apply for ILR via the Skilled Worker route but my visa expires before I can apply for ILR. I got my Tier 2 visa by converting from a Tier 4 visa after I finished my studies, so my date of entry is before the visa issue date. Here are the relevant dates:

* Tier 2 visa issue date - 19/09/2019
* Tier 2 visa expiry date - 18/08/2024
* 5 years from visa issue date - 19/09/2024
* 5 years minus 28 days - 22/08/2024

As you can see, my visa expires JUST before 5 years minus 28 days of continuous residence (CR) due to it only lasting 4 years and 11 months (although I applied for a 5-year visa).

From this comment by Zimba, viewtopic.php?t=336290#p2110176, it sounds like it is possible to submit my ILR application before my visa expires (so I can continue staying in the UK after my visa expires), and only provide biometrics when I qualify for 5 years of CR.

My question is when will I qualify for 5 years of CR and when should I provide my biometrics? Is it anytime after 22/08/2024 or does it have to be after I hit full 5 years (19/09/2024)? I intend on using the super priority service so I assume my application will be processed within 2 days of providing my biometrics.
You must count backwards from whichever of the following is most beneficial to the
applicant to see whether they meet the qualifying period:
• the date of application
• any date up to 28 days after the date of application
• the date of decision
• for a person seeking settlement on the UK Ancestry route, the date of their last
grant of permission
Based on the above, the date of decision will probably be the most beneficial to me. Does the date of decision have to be after 22/08/2024 or 19/09/2024 for me to qualify?

The date of decision is the most beneficial.

You can apply anytime before the expiry date of your current visa and then book biometrics on/from the day you qualify, i.e. 22/08/2024, then you will be eligible when a decision is made within the super-priority timeframe (provided this service is available to you when applying).
